Introduction
Wayne Gretzky played on 4 different teams in his long hockey career. He played for the Edmonton Oilers, Los Angeles Kings, St. Louis Blues and the New York Rangers.

Edmonton Oilers
The first team Gretzky played was the Edmonton Oilers. He played with them for 9 seasons, starting in 1979 and ending in 1988. On his third year with the Oilers he had the highest scoring season in his career. He scored 92 goals in his 1981-82 year. In the season 1983-1984 season Wayne finished with 295 career points. Though he did not know it at the time that would be the most points he scored in a single season. After his finial season in 1988 Gretzky was traded to the Los Angeles Kings.
Los Angeles Kings
Wayne played with the Kings for 7 years, starting in 1988 and playing until 1995. When Gretzky started with the Kings it was the teams first year in the NHL. In 1989 Gretzky beat Gordie HoweÅ› record of 1,850 total career points. He finished his career with 2,857 points, beating HoweÅ› record by 1,007 points.
St.Louis Blues
Gretzky played with the Blues for less than one season. He played 18 games and left the team with an unimpressive total of 8 goals scored. Before the 1996 season even ended Gretzky moved the the New York Rangers
New York Rangers
Wayne played for the Rangers for 3 years and finished his career in 1999. In his final season he managed to score only 9 goals. Unfortunately The Great Gretzky ended off on a bad note. Even though his last season was not the best, Wayne Gretzky was still a great hockey player.
